Learning targets for endocrine:
1. I can distinguish between endocrine and exocrine glands and define the term" hormone"
2. I can identify the principal functions of each major endocrine hormone and describe the conditions that may result from hyposecretion and hypersecretion of that hormone
3. I can describe the mechanism of steroid and nonsteroid hormone action,and how hormones move throughout the body
4. I can explain how negative and positive feedback mechanisms regulate the secretion of hormones and maintain homeostasis
5. I can identify and locate the primary endocrine glands , list the major hormones produced by each gland and identify disorders of the endocrine system
6. I can explain how the endocrine and nervous system work together to regulate body functions
